[ES] La costa gallega se ha visto afectada regularmente por el vertido de hidrocarburos. La determinación de los puntos de arribada del hidrocarburo así como el tiempo transcurrido desde el vertido es un proceso que debe realizarse de forma casi inmediata para minimizar su efecto sobre los ecosistemas. Es ahí donde cobran especial relevancia los modelos de dispersión de partículas para el seguimiento del crudo, ya que permiten tanto una rápida ejecución como el análisis de diferentes escenarios. Estos modelos, donde el principal forzamiento es el eólico proporcionado por modelos meteorológicos, dependen en gran medida de la precisión de las predicciones meteorológicas. Las predicciones suministradas por MeteoGalicia se comparan con los datos reales medidos por el satélite QuikSCAT, mostrando una alta correlación entre ambas fuentes, aunque los datos de QuikSCAT son de una magnitud ligeramente mayor en alrededor de un 15%
[EN] The Galician coast has suffered the periodic impact of oil spills. Predicting the spill extension, the most probable points of impact and the arrival time is a process that should be carried out immediately to decrease the effect on marine life. In these situations, the use of particle tracking models is very important because they allow a fast execution taking into account different scenarios. These models, where the main forcing is the wind provided by meteorological models, depend to a great extent on the accuracy of meteorological predictions. The prediction provided by MeteoGalicia is compared with real data measured by the QuikSCAT satellite, showing a high correlation between both databases, although QuikSCAT data are slightly higher (about 15%) in magnitude
